An outdoor AP (Access Point) is a rugged networking device designed to extend Wi-Fi coverage to outdoor spaces like yards, parks, and campuses. Built with weatherproof enclosures, it ensures reliable, long-range wireless connectivity in harsh environments. The $200 million project, spearheaded by Mawarid Turbine Company, is designed to produce up to 1GW of wind turbines annually, as announced by Oman's Ministry of Energy. Eng Salim bin Nasser al Aufi, Minister of Energy and Minerals, underscored the strategic role of the facility in supporting Oman's renewable energy goals. The Mawarid Turbine Company celebrated the launch of the first phase of a specialised factory in the Special Economic Zone at Duqm to manufacture wind turbines, with an annual production capacity of up to 1,000 megawatts.
